Please don't think that I just sit around all the time! For many years I went to the weaving mill. I had to learn everything from the first basics. First spinning. This was very arduous. Then I had to set up the loom. We had to tension the warp with metres and metres of thread. And threading through the comb was a never ending job, before I could finally start weaving. I wove nice coloured fabrics for aprons, kitchen towels, tablecloths and much more. We had a good time. We sang and laughed. We were a good community. Now I want to rest, I need some peace. I just like to remember. You have no idea what it was like. Ernestine.
